The Gentle Giants: A Brief Introduction

Before we delve into the sad tales of hippo killing humans, let's appreciate these incredible beasts for what they are - the third-largest living land mammals, after elephants and white rhinos. Weighing up to 4,000 kg (8,800 lb) and measuring up to 4.3 m (14 ft) in length, hippos are anything but subtle. They're known for their powerful jaws, which can open up to 150 degrees, and their massive teeth, which can reach up to 50 cm (20 in) in length. But don't let their intimidating appearance fool you; hippos are generally peaceful creatures, spending most of their days lounging in the sun or wallowing in mud to protect their sensitive skin from the sun.

When Peace Turns into Fury: Understanding Hippo Aggression

Now, you might be wondering, "Why do hippos attack humans?" The answer lies in their territorial nature and the threat perception. Here are a few scenarios that might trigger an aggressive hippo attack:

1. Territorial Defense: Hippos are highly territorial, especially males during the mating season. They'll defend their territory, including their young, with fierce determination. An approaching human, especially one wielding a weapon like a fishing spear, can be perceived as a threat.

2. Surprise Encounters: Hippos are mostly active at night, making them less visible during the day. A sudden encounter with a human, perhaps during a late-night swim or a morning jog, can startle the hippo, leading to an attack.

3. Provocation: Intentional or unintentional provocation, such as throwing objects at the hippo or cornering it, can also lead to an attack.

The Statistics: How Common Are Hippo Attacks?

While hippo attacks on humans are rare, they're not unheard of. According to the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N), hippos are responsible for around 500 human fatalities each year. This makes them one of the most dangerous large mammals in Africa. However, it's essential to put these numbers into perspective. Africa is home to over one billion people, many of whom live in close proximity to hippo habitats. So, while the numbers are alarming, the actual risk of being attacked by a hippo is relatively low.

Surviving an Encounter: Tips from Experts

If you ever find yourself in a situation where you might encounter a hippo, here are some tips to keep in mind:

- Maintain a Safe Distance: Stay at least 100 meters (330 feet) away from hippos. If you're closer than that, you're in their danger zone.

- Never Get Between a Hippo and the Water: Hippos are most dangerous when they're between the water and the land. They'll defend their young and their territory with everything they've got.

- Make Noise: Hippos are often startled by sudden encounters. Making noise as you approach the water can alert them to your presence and give them a chance to move away.

- Back Away Slowly: If a hippo does charge, back away slowly and quietly. Running will only trigger their chase instinct.

The Role of Conservation in Preventing Hippo Attacks

Hippos play a crucial role in their ecosystems, and their populations are currently stable. However, climate change and habitat loss pose significant threats to these creatures. By supporting conservation efforts, we can help protect hippos and their habitats, reducing the likelihood of human-hippo conflicts.

Moreover, education plays a significant role in preventing hippo attacks. By teaching local communities and tourists about hippo behavior and the importance of maintaining a safe distance, we can help reduce the number of these tragic incidents.
